it-sa Award: 10 cybersecurity start-ups in the pitch: audience decides who wins the UP21 @ it-sa Award. Prevoting phase on September 9th in the final pitch event on the it-sa 365 dialogue platform.
Ten IT security start-ups from Germany, Austria and Switzerland have the chance to win the UP @ it-sa Award this year. They were already able to convince the expert jury with innovative technical approaches and future-proof business models - and are now facing the vote of the IT security community: During the pre-voting phase and on September 9 in the final pitch event on the it-sa 365 dialogue platform. The winner will be honored live at it-sa 14 on October 2021th. The trade fair for IT security products and solutions will take place from October 12th to 14th in the Nuremberg Exhibition Center.
The nominated applicants pursue different ideas to strengthen trust in digital technologies. What they have in common is the innovative strength for more data protection and the security of IT infrastructures.

Nominated by the jury
The ten cybersecurity start-ups nominated for the pitch were already able to clear the first hurdle: They convinced the jury made up of IT security specialists, industry representatives and last year's winner asvin. The jury not only focused on the degree of innovation of the young companies, the business model also had to score.

It-sa is the largest trade fair for IT security in Europe and also holds a leading position in global comparison. Congress @ it-sa offers decision-makers and experts additional know-how.
it-sa 365 offers innovative dialogue formats all year round to network IT security providers online with IT security officers from management and technology.
